Effect of ram introduction and hormonal treatment on fertility in seasonally anestrous Suffolk ewes raised under different photoperiod during perinatal period

This study was conducted to examine fertility in out-of-seasonal breeding using practical treatments available to sheep farm.<BR>Thirty-three Suffolk ewes were supplemented artificial light (L, n =18) or maintained on natural daylength (N, n =15) during perinatal period (February to March). All ewes gave birth to lambs. After weaning, Seasonally anestrous those ewes were divided into following 3 groups : <BR>Group A (L : n = 5, N : n = 6), ewes were introduced fertile ram for 38 days from May 26 ;<BR>Group B (L : n =7, N : n =4), ewes were introduced ram similarly to group A, and given an injection of PMSG at May 26 followed 13 days later (June 8) by an injection of PMSG and PGF <SUB>2α</SUB> ;<BR>Group C (L : n = 6, N : n = 5), ewes were introduced fertile ram for 25 days from June 8, and given hormonal injections similarly to group B. <BR>Returns to service were monitored for three consecutive cycles and this was facilitated by changing the raddle colour every 13 days. <BR>The incidence of estrus in groups A, B and C was 45%, 82% and 36%, respectively. The incidence of estrus in group B was higher than that of group C (P < 0.05). The conception rate was identical between group A and B (45%), but that in group C was 9%. The incidence of estrus in ewes supplemented artificial light during perinatal period was higher than that in ewes maintained on natural daylength (78%, 14/18 vs. 27%, 4/15, P < 0.01). The conception rate in ewes supplemented artificial light was higher than that in ewes maintained on natural daylength (50%, 9/18 vs. 13%, 2/15, P < 0.05). <BR>The present results suggested that Suffolk ewes raised in Hokkaido, supplemented artificial light during perinatal period (February to March), were responsive to 'male effect' in late May, and the additional hormonal treatment using PMSG and PGF<SUB>2</SUB>α induced cyclic estrous activity in these ewes, which could be one of the out-of-seasonal breeding systems in practice.
